Cash price Discounted cash price What a hospital charges a self-pay patient who pays directly, without going through insurance — usually well below the gross charge. Example: A CT scan has a $3,200 gross charge but an $850 discounted cash price. Ask for it by name when scheduling — hospitals don't always advertise it up front.

Gross charge Gross charge (chargemaster price) The hospital's full, undiscounted list price — pulled from its internal "chargemaster" price list. Almost no one actually pays this. Example: A chest X-ray has a gross charge of $1,450. The same hospital's discounted cash price for the same X-ray is $180 — the gross charge mostly anchors negotiations, not what patients pay.
